The Small Time Film Festival, held in [Location], invites both seasoned and first-time filmmakers to showcase their creativity with video entries of 60 seconds or less, centered around the prompt "60 seconds that change the future." This unique festival encourages diverse storytelling, whether shot on an iPhone or a vintage 16mm camera. All proceeds support The Lighthouse Mission, aiding those in need.
